What they do

A Purchasing Manager manages the purchasing of supplies for a company or organization. Develops policies and schedules for regular procurements. Trains and supervises staff, develops relationships with suppliers, researches and inspects supplies, and negotiates supply and shipping prices.

Everton Homes is a premier builder of luxury modern homes in Bellevue, Kirkland, and Redmond. Our mission is to deliver high-quality, custom-built homes that meet the unique needs of our homebuyers. We are looking for an experienced and detail-oriented Purchasing Manager to join our team.
Position Overview:
The Purchasing manager is responsible for creating construction project specs and managing the procurement of construction materials necessary. This role requires strong construction knowledge, negotiation sk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work closely with project managers, suppliers, and subcontractors to ensure smooth and on time project execution.
Key Responsibilities:
Collaborate with project managers, architects and interior designers to create and refine complete project spec for a custom home. Research, source and purchase construction materials, ensuring cost-effectiveness and quality. Negotiate pricing, terms, and contracts with suppliers. Coordinate with project managers to align material deliveries with project schedules. Review and manage purchase orders, invoices, and ensure accurate documentation. Provide regular reports on cost-saving initiatives, keep track of subcontractor performance.
Qualifications:
Extensive experience in homebuilding and construction is required. Experience in purchasing and procurement within the homebuilding industry is required. Strong negotiation skills and knowledge of construction materials and supplies.
